On the Bartnik mass of apparent horizons

TL;DR: In this article, the intrinsic geometry of apparent horizons (outermost marginally outer trapped surfaces) in asymptotically flat spacetimes is characterized and the minimal ADM mass of a spacetime containing such an apparent horizon is derived.

Total Mean Curvature, Scalar Curvature, and a Variational Analog of Brown–York Mass

TL;DR: In this paper, the supremum of the total mean curvature on the boundary of compact, mean-convex 3-manifolds with nonnegative scalar curvature, and a prescribed boundary metric were studied.
